The educational sector in northwest Syria is suffering from issues affecting both staff and infrastructure. Public schools are experiencing persistent crises, a lack of necessary supplies, reduced support, shortages of heating fuel and schoolbooks, and low teacher salaries. These challenges renew at the beginning of each school year, despite efforts to rejuvenate the educational sector from responsible bodies or civil society organizations. Nevertheless, their efforts remain insufficient given the scale of the needs.
